Changeset 857c0e7 in mainline for kernel/arch/ia64/src/start.S


Ignore:
Timestamp:
2007-09-09T21:05:23Z (17 years ago)
Author:
Jakub Vana <jakub.vana@…>
Branches:
l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
Children:
743ffa6e
Parents:
c785296
Message:

IA64 loader parameter

File:
1 edited

Legend:

Unmodified
Added
Removed
  • kernel/arch/ia64/src/start.S

    rc785296 r857c0e7  
    108108
    109109        # initialize gp (Global Pointer) register
     110        mov r20 = r1 ;;
    110111        movl r1 = _hardcoded_load_address
    111112
     
    119120        addl r18 = @gprel(hardcoded_kdata_size), gp
    120121        addl r19 = @gprel(hardcoded_load_address), gp
     122        addl r21 = @gprel(bootinfo), gp
    121123        ;;
    122124        st8 [r17] = r14
    123125        st8 [r18] = r15
    124126        st8 [r19] = r16
     127        st8 [r21] = r20
    125128
    126129        ssm (1 << 19) ;; /* Disable f32 - f127 */
Note: See TracChangeset for help on using the changeset viewer.